Transaction 21c76b0b3afee4912047be618a3c8a0d08e848a7b29ec3a1a79cbdc4659766cf

3 Input
2 Outputs
  • 21c76b0b3afee4912047be618a3c8a0d08e848a7b29ec3a1a79cbdc4659766cf:0
  • value  2235805
    address  1QECE5VurHY21LVC85sS5zAXPry37bXxXu
  • 21c76b0b3afee4912047be618a3c8a0d08e848a7b29ec3a1a79cbdc4659766cf:1
  • value  1053091
    address  1AftFH8VdXio99ugzfe7zj6fqyQ3KEKapC